Although the process of reading the verdict was somewhat tedious, as the 1,231-page verdict was read from November 4 to 12, Downing was still very excited to hear it, because the verdict affirmed that Japan's domestic and foreign policies during the period under review (1928-1945) were aimed at preparing and waging wars of aggression.

The International Military Tribunal for the Far East also pronounced sentences on many war criminals, including seven Class-A war criminals, including Hideki Tojo, Kenji Dohihara, Seishiro Itagaki, Ishine Matsui, Hyotaro Kimura, Hiroki Hirota, and Akira Muto, and were hanged on the death rack of Sugamo Prison in Tokyo in the early morning of December 23, 1948. In addition, Sugiyama committed suicide after learning that he had been declared a Class-A war criminal, but former Foreign Minister Yoyo Matsuoka and former Admiral Osamu Nagano died of illness.

The International Military Tribunal for the Far East also sentenced 16 people to life imprisonment (Sadao Araki, Shingoro Hashimoto, Shunroku Hatata, Kiichiro Hiranuma, Naoki Hoshino, Konobu Kaguya, Koichi Kido, Kuniaaki Koiso, Minamijiro, Keijun Oka, Hiroshi Oshima, Kenri Sato, Shigetaro Hatota, Toshio Shiratori, Mijiro Umezu, Sadaichi Suzu); Two people were sentenced to fixed-term imprisonment (20 years for Shigetoku Togo and 7 years for Shigemitsu Aoi).

In addition to the Tokyo trials, the Allies also tried Class B and C war criminals in Manila, Singapore, Yangon, Saigon, and Boli. According to statistics, the total number of Japanese war criminals of various types prosecuted by the allies was 5,423, and 4,226 were sentenced, of which 941 were sentenced to death.

Although the Tokyo Trial was a serious and just trial, which punished war criminals, upheld the dignity of international law, and made significant contributions to the development of the cause of human peace, which was of epoch-making significance, this trial was not perfect, not only was Kido Koichi and others later released from prison, but what is even more exaggerated is that Kishi Nobusuke, who was originally designated as a Class A war criminal, was actually acquitted in 1948, and became the prime minister of Japan in 1957.

For Okamura Ninji, I believe that every Chinese will be no stranger, this Japanese army general born in 1884, served as the commander-in-chief of Japan's Chinese dispatch army at the end of the Anti-Japanese War. Located in the third place of the Showa warlord's three feather black. He graduated from the Japanese Army Non-commissioned Officer School in 1904 and participated in the Russo-Japanese War in April 1905.

After the outbreak of the '918' incident, he served as deputy chief of staff of the Kwantung Army. After the outbreak of the All-out War of Resistance Against Japanese Aggression, he participated in the Japanese invasion of China, and was promoted to commander-in-chief of the Japanese invasion of China in 1944. On September 9, 1945, on behalf of the Japanese invasion of China, he signed the instrument of surrender in Nanjing. In February 1949, he was dramatically tried by the Kuomintang military court for Chiang Kai-shek's patronage and was 'acquitted', and was later hired by Chiang Kai-shek as a senior instructor in Taiwan, and the Japanese right-wing forces appointed him as the vice president of the 'Japanese Comrades-in-Arms Association'. He died in Tokyo in 1966.
